Dealing with Leaf Buildup on Solar Panels
When it comes to leaf management for optimal solar panel performance, regular maintenance is key. Cleaning and inspection are essential to ensure that leaf buildup does not compromise the effectiveness of your solar panels.
For leaf removal on solar panels, you should use a soft-bristled brush or a leaf blower on the lowest setting to remove any excess debris. It is important to avoid using sharp tools or cleaning agents that could scratch or damage the surface of your solar panels.
Maximising Solar Panel Efficiency
Minimising leaf interference is also crucial to maximise solar panel efficiency. By trimming any overhanging branches, you can prevent leaves from accumulating on your solar panels during the autumn season. Moreover, keeping nearby trees well-maintained and removing any dead or excess branches can help prevent leaf buildup and its implications on solar panels.
Another tip for mitigating leaf interference on solar panels is the installation of a leaf-proof system. This system consists of a mesh or screen that covers the surface of your solar panels and prevents debris from accumulating. The best time to install this system is during the spring months, ensuring that it is in place before the leaf shedding season begins in the autumn.

Leaf Accumulation and its Impact on Solar Panel Effectiveness
As leaves accumulate on your solar panels, they can have a negative impact on the effectiveness of your solar energy system. One of the main issues that arises from leaf accumulation is leaf blocking. When leaves cover the surface of solar panels, they can prevent sunlight from reaching the solar cells.
Sunlight is the main source of energy for solar panels, so when it’s blocked, the energy production of your system decreases. Even a small amount of leaf blocking can reduce the efficiency of your solar panels. Over time, this can add up and significantly impact the overall effectiveness of your solar energy system.
